The Sumida AS9717 series power inductor, available from Supreme Components International, an authorised distributor, is engineered for optimal performance in power management circuits. This inductor boasts a compact design while delivering exceptional current handling capabilities. The AS9717 is well-suited for a variety of applications, including DC-DC converters, voltage regulators, and power supplies.
